Leg of lamb Garlic, slivered Lemon juice Salt Slice bottom of leg; make slits in lamb and insert as many slivers of garlic as possible, till bottom is as covered as can be. Cover with lemon juice and salt. Place lamb on rack in pan with a little water to steam. Cook at 325 degrees F.; don't baste or turn. (Use leftovers in Shepherd's Pie!)

MY MOTHER-IN-LAWS DURBAN STYLE LAMB CURRY
A visit to DURBAN is not complete unless you have an authentic Durban style lamb curry. This meal is a staple in most South African homes and todays recipe has been passed down to my mother-in-law by her mother. A true DURBAN style Indian curry.

Prep Time : 10 Mins Cuisine : Indian Cooking Time : 50 Mins Total Time: 1 Hour Servings : 6 - 8 People
INGREDIENTS • 1.5 KG Lamb • 1 Whole Onion • 3 Tomatoes liquidised • 3 Medium-Large Potatoes • 1/2 Cup Oil • Curry Leaves • 1 TBSPN Ginger & Garlic Paste • 3 Chillies Sliced • 1 TSPN Whole Breyani Mix Spice • 1 Bay Leaf • 1/2 TSPN Tumeric • 1 TSPN Dhania & Jeera Powder • 2 TSPN Garam Masala • 5 TBSPN Kashmiri Special Mix Masala • Rough Salt • 1/2-1 Cup Hot Water • Coriander
METHOD 1. Add oil to a medium heated pot. 2. Add in onions & mix. 3. Add in whole breyani spices, bay leaf, chillies, curry leaves & ginger & garlic paste and mix until everything is coated well. 4. Add in tumeric, dhania & jeera spice and garam masala and stir until everything is mixed into the oil. 5. Add in kashmiri masala and mix well. 6. Add in tomatoes & mix well for 2 mins and allow to simmer for about 5-7 mins. 7. Add in lamb and mix well until all the meat is coated and allow to simmer for 20 mins. Stir occasionally every 5-7 mins. 8. Add in 1/2 cup of hot water and mix well and allo to simmer for 5 mins. 9. Place the potatoes around around the meat and allow to simmer in the gravy until cooked. 10. Garnish with coriander and serve.
SERVING OPTIONS You can serve this curry with the following: Rice, Bread, Roti Or Naan.
